In the UK, the demand for professionals with a Certificate in EV Charging: Location Planning & Analysis is on the rise. As the electric vehicle (EV) industry continues to grow, so does the need for experts in EV charging infrastructure planning and analysis. Let's take a closer look at three primary roles in this field and their respective market trends: 1. **Electric Vehicle Infrastructure Planner**: These professionals are responsible for designing and implementing EV charging infrastructure, ensuring seamless integration with existing power grids and transportation networks. Approximately 60% of the jobs in this sector fall under this role. 2. **Location Analyst for EV Charging Stations**: These analysts utilize geospatial data to identify optimal locations for EV charging stations, taking into account factors like population density, traffic patterns, and existing infrastructure. They account for about 30% of the job opportunities in this field. 3. **Data Scientist (EV Charging)**: Data scientists working in the EV charging sector analyze large datasets to identify trends, patterns, and insights, ultimately driving strategic decision-making. While this role represents only 10% of the jobs in the industry, its importance is paramount for long-term growth and sustainability.
